Martin Alexander 1687–1751 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 18 Mar 1687

Birth Location: Annemessex, Somerset, Maryland, United States

Death Date: 16 Aug 1751

Death Location: New Munster, Cecil County, Maryland

Father: Samuel Alexander

Mother: Mary Taylor

Spouse(s): Susannah Foster

Children(s): Rebecca Alexander, Aaron Alexander, Eli Alexander, David Alexander, Ezekiel Alexander, Moses Alexander, James Alexander, William Alexander

Martin Alexander was born in 1687 in Annemessex, Somerset, Maryland, United States, the child of Samuel Alexander And Mary Taylor. Martin Alexander married Susannah Foster, and had children including Aaron Alexander, David Alexander, Eli Alexander, Ezekiel Alexander, James Alexander, Moses Alexander, Rebecca Alexander, William Alexander. Martin Alexander passed away in 1751 in New Munster, Cecil County, Maryland.
